Overview of Chamber Music musician Echo Collective

A classical and chamber music ensemble from Brussels, Belgium is called Echo Collective. The group consists of accomplished musicians with talent who want to produce captivating and stirring live performances. Echo Collective's music aims to push the boundaries of classical music while fostering a sense of closeness and connection with their listeners.

Their music is a fusion of conventional Classical music and avant-garde chamber music. Acoustic and electronic instruments are judiciously combined in Echo Collective's music to produce a fascinating and ethereal experience for the listener. What are the latest songs and music albums for Chamber Music musician Echo Collective?

The Belgian classical and chamber music performer Echo Collective has constantly put out captivating music that has won over listeners all around the world. The See Within, their most recent album, was published in 2020 and offers their distinctive fusion of experimental and classical elements. This album demonstrates the group's capacity to produce expressive and nuanced music that defies categorization with songs like "The See Within" and "Wistful Breath."

Echo Collective has also released a number of singles that demonstrate their versatility as musicians in addition to their album. Songs like "Inflection Point" and "The Witching Hour" showcase the group's aptitude for atmospheric and eerie sound design that is ideal for reflective listening.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Chamber Music musician Echo Collective?

A chamber music ensemble from Belgium called Echo Collective has worked with many different musicians over the years to create some amazing compositions. With Johann Johannsson, they produced one of their most notable songs, "Zurich." The complex instruments and eerie tunes were the ideal complement to Johannsson's distinctive sound. The track demonstrates the versatility of both Echo Collective and Johannsson and is a lovely fusion of classical and ambient music.

With Christina Vantzou and Deradoorian, an outstanding cooperation was made on the song "Glissando for Bodies and Machines in Space." The track explores the interaction between the human body and technology and combines electronic and classical instrumentation. The outcome is a beautiful and thought-provoking music that is ethereal and eerie.
